Community Transitional Services
(CTS) - individually designed services intended to assist a waiver
participant to transition from a nursing home to living in the community. CTS
is a one-time service per waiver enrollment. If the waiver participant has been
discontinued from the program and now is a resident of a nursing home, they can
access this service again, if needed. This service is only provided when
transitioning from a nursing home. These funds are not available to move from
the participant's home in the community to another location in the community.
The funding limits for this service are separate and apart from the limits
applied to Moving Assistance, and the two services will not be used at the same
time in any approved Service Plan.
This service includes: the cost of moving furniture and
other belongings, security deposits, including broker's fees required to obtain
a lease on an apartment or home; purchasing essential furnishings; set-up fees
or deposits for utility or service access (e.g. telephone, electricity,
heating); and health and safety assurances such as pest removal, allergen
control or one time cleaning prior to occupancy. |
